Business Context and Reporting Period
Ryanair Holdings PLC, Europe's No. 1 airline, filed a Form 6-K on March 20, 2026. The filing announces a strategic capital investment to expand its maintenance capabilities at Prestwick Airport in Scotland.
Key Financial Metrics and Investment Details
- Capital Expenditure: £40 million allocated for the expansion of the Prestwick maintenance facility.
- Project Scope: Construction of a new 11,938 sqm, 4-bay heavy maintenance hangar and additional component workshops.
- Operational Capacity: Expansion increases the facility from 6 to 10 bays, establishing it as Ryanair's largest heavy maintenance hangar.
- Employment Impact: Creation of 450 new highly skilled engineer and mechanic jobs, including 60 apprenticeship roles.
- Total Workforce: The expansion supports a total of over 1,200 engineering and mechanic jobs in Ayrshire.
Note: The filing does not provide specific values for revenue, profit, cash flow, margins, debt, or liquidity for the reporting period.
Material Changes and Strategic Developments
This announcement represents a significant material change in Ryanair's infrastructure footprint, building upon a recent £5 million investment in the Prestwick Training Academy opened in October 2024. The combined investments aim to service a growing fleet projected to reach 800 aircraft by 2034.
Outlook, Management Commentary, and Risks
Management Commentary: CEO Eddie Wilson emphasized the company's long-term commitment to Scotland and the development of aviation talent. The expansion is positioned as crucial for supporting the fleet's growth to 800 aircraft and 300 million passengers by 2034.
Outlook: The project reinforces Prestwick's status as a key aircraft maintenance and training hub within Ryanair's network.
Risks and Contingencies: The filing does not explicitly detail financial risks or contingencies associated with this specific project, though it notes reliance on partnerships with government bodies (Scottish Govt, UK Govt, South Ayrshire Council) and local entities for support.
